The Denver Regional Transportation District (RTD) confirmed that BRT facilities were on the organisation’s radar for the city and wider county.
Early environmental work is currently being carried out for the plans, but the RTD is considering partnering with the private sector to further develop the projects and potentially carry out the work under a P3.
“P3 is a possibility, the plans are at an early stage but BRT is certainly an area we are looking at,” said Pranaya Shrethsa, manager of systems engineering at the RTD.
The city of Denver is widely known to have overseen the successful procurement of one of the first US P3s, with the closing of the Denver Eagle P3 in 2010.
